    5-21-1977

    Wilfredo "Bazooka" Gomez KO's Dong Kyun Yum in San Juan, PR, to win the WBC super bantamweight championship

    Marvelous Marvin Hagler was born on this day 23 MAY 1954

    Carlos Zarate was born on the same day in 1951

    In 1922 Harry Greb W 15 Gene Turnney, NYC Wins U.S Light Heavyweight Title. Tens seconds into the first round Greb breaks Tunneys nose, then later in the same round opens a huge gash over Tunney's left eye, then in the third round busts up Tunney's right eye. Over 15 rounds Tunney lost an estimated 2 quarts of blood. The blood was so thick on Grebs gloves he had to step back and hold them out so that referee Kid Partland could wipe them with a towel.
